Roll coating definition

Roll coating means the application of a coating material to a substrate by means of hard rubber or steel rolls.
Roll coating means the application of a coating material to a moving substrate by means of hard rubber, elastomeric, or metal rolls.
Roll coating means a coating method using a machine that applies coating to a substrate by continuously transferring coating through a set of oppositely rotating rollers;

  • Roll coating is a process by which a thin liquid film is formed on a continuous web or substrate by the use of two or more rotating rolls.

  • Roll coating is a method of applying adhesive to a flat sheet or strip where the coating is transferred by a roller or series of rollers.
